Learn key facts about Diploma in Purchasing, Supplier Management And Negotiation
● The Diploma in Purchasing, Supplier Management And Negotiation is a comprehensive program designed to equip students with the essential skills and knowledge needed to excel in the field of procurement and supply chain management.
● Upon completion of the course, students will be able to effectively manage supplier relationships, negotiate contracts, and optimize purchasing processes to drive organizational success.
● This diploma is highly relevant to industries such as manufacturing, retail, healthcare, and logistics, where effective procurement and supplier management are critical to business operations.
● The curriculum covers a wide range of topics including strategic sourcing, vendor evaluation, contract management, and risk mitigation, providing students with a well-rounded understanding of the procurement function.
● One of the unique features of this course is the emphasis on practical skills development, with hands-on exercises, case studies, and simulations that allow students to apply their knowledge in real-world scenarios.
● The program is taught by industry experts with extensive experience in procurement and supply chain management, ensuring that students receive relevant and up-to-date information that is directly applicable to their future careers.
● Graduates of the Diploma in Purchasing, Supplier Management And Negotiation can pursue various roles such as procurement manager, supply chain analyst, purchasing specialist, and contract negotiator, in a wide range of industries around the world.
